Ireland · Question · written

PQ 259

251 Deputy Jan O’Sullivan asked the Minister for Health and Children if her attention has been drawn to the fact that there is an eight year waiting list for the dermatology outpatients clinic in the Mid-West Regional Hospital with 2,300 people on the list and that the list is closed to new patients except those with very serious conditions; the action she will take to address this issue;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[14421/08]
